Position: Forward
College: University of Vermont
Marqus Blakely, born on October 22, 1988 in Metuchen, New Jersey, U.S., is a dynamic and versatile forward known for his athleticism and tenacity. A standout at the University of Vermont, he has achieved success in various international leagues, earning multiple championships and individual accolades. Beyond the court, Blakely is dedicated to community involvement, regularly participating in charity events and basketball clinics. His inspiring journey serves as a testament to the rewards of hard work and passion in the world of basketball.

Career
2006–2010:
Attends and graduates the University of Vermont, excelling on and off the court. Wins the Kevin Roberson America East Conference Men's Basketball Player of the Year twice and the America East Defensive Player of the Year Award three times.
2010:
Undrafted in the NBA draft, joins the Los Angeles Clippers for the 2010 NBA Summer League. Signs a two-year partially guaranteed contract
2010–2011:
Joins Bakersfield Jam in the NBA D-League, showcasing talent with 17.2 points per game. Later traded to the Iowa Energy where he won a NBA D league championship coach by Nick Nurse
2011:
NBA Call up with the Houston Rockets, entering training camp.
2011–2012:
Returns to Iowa Energy, then traded to Sioux Falls Skyforce. Named NBA D-League All-Star.
2012:
Signs with B-Meg Llamados in the Philippine Basketball Association (PBA), averaging a double-double. Leads team to PBA Finals
2013:
Expands career to Germany with Neckar Riesen Ludwigsburg.
2013–2015:
Returns to the PBA, now with San Mig Coffee Mixers. Wins two PBA championships and achieves a historic Grand Slam (4 Titles consequently)
2015–2016:
Gets recruited to play in the (KBL) Korean Basketball League with Busan KT Sonicboom.
2016:
Returns to the PBA, playing for the Star Hotshots.
2018:
Signs with TNT KaTropa in the PBA, nearly recording a triple-double in his debut.
2018–2019:
Recruited to Japan to play in the B league for Shiga Lakestars and Fukuoka Zephyr where he records a triple-double with 37 points, 11 rebounds, and 12 assists.
2019:
Joins the Blackwater Elite in the PBA, scoring a conference-high 37 points.
2020:
Signs with the Kumamoto Volters in the Japan’s B League, recording a triple-double of 24 points, 16 rebounds, and 11 assists in his first game.
